Reserving a name
(1) A person may lodge an application in the prescribed form with ASIC to reserve a name for a registrable Australian body or a foreign company. If the name is available, ASIC must reserve it. Note: For available names, see section 601DC. (2) The reservation lasts for 2 months from the date when the application was lodged. An applicant may ask ASIC in writing for an extension of the reservation during a period that the name is reserved, and ASIC may extend the reservation for 2 months. (3) ASIC must cancel a reservation if the applicant asks ASIC in writing to do so.
